Carbon Filters & Odour Control FAQ's
Match the filter's flange to your fan and duct size — 100–150mm for small tents, 150–200mm for mid-size setups, 250mm+ for rooms. Then check the airflow rating: the filter's m³/h figure should meet or exceed your fan's, so air spends long enough in the carbon bed to be scrubbed properly.
Until its breakthrough point — the moment you first notice odour from the ducting, when heavier molecules start displacing lighter ones from saturated carbon. There's no fixed calendar: high humidity and dusty rooms shorten the life, a pre-filter sock and running within the filter's rated airflow extend it. Longer canisters last longer than short ones of the same diameter.

No — they solve a different problem. The carbon filter scrubs the air your fan extracts; ONA neutralises ambient smell in the room around the grow, entry points and gear. Serious setups run both. Keep ONA products near the grow area, not inside the tent with ripening plants.
Inside, at the start of the run: filter → fan → ducting → out. The fan pulls tent air through the carbon first, which also keeps dust out of the fan. Hanging it high catches the warmest, smelliest air and leaves your floor space free.
